A Structure of feeling is a social experience as distinct from other social semantic formations which have been precipitated and are more evidently and more immediately available.

A Structure of feeling is a kind of practical consciousness. That is, it is the affective elements of consciousness: Not feeling against thought, but thought as felt and feeling as thought.

A Structure of feeling is characterized as a concern with specific feelings, specific rhythms which account for a specific kind of sociality which are only conceivable insofar as they haven't been reduced analytically into set categories of social experience.

A Structure of feeling is a social experience still in process which on the one hand is not yet recognized as social and taken to be private, idiosyncratic, and even isolating, but on the other, in analysis shows itself to have the character of a structure.
